I also applied recently to Big Brothers/Big Sisters. I was told that they were still pairing big brothers up with little brothers for the school mentoring program (which is what I would like to do), even though that is typically reserved for people who can volunteer for a full school year (I cannot as I'll graduate this May and will leave over the summer). I must have been told wrong because the woman that called me up following the interview said she'd have to get the green light from HER boss if I was going to mentor for only a semester. I'm still waiting for a call back after speaking with her.

How often and what type of kids? (like orphans?)
Usually you hang out with them once a week and the kids are identified as problematic in some way (they almost always come from underprivileged backgrounds and broken households).

How do these families trust their kids with complete strangers? I mean it's not like babysitting where you're at least asked to stay in the house (and usually to be a girl) but you get to take them out, right?
With the school mentoring program at least, you don't take the kid off of the school premises. They also do an extensive criminal background check on all applicants.
